- NFS share on Linux system
- Port Forwarding in Docker
- Proxy manager
- Types of volume in Docker and the difference between them
- Build and push images into AWS ECR and Dockerhub
- DTR
- Differnce between docker, Docker Compose and Docker stack
- Docker Swarm
- Networking in docker, Docker Compose and Docker Swarm
- Docker Art
- Image scan (Security)
- All below Instructions in Dockerfile
- FROM
- ADD
- CMD
- ENTRYPOINT
- ENV
- EXPOSE
- MAINTAINER
- RUN
- USER
- VOLUME
- WORKDIR
- LABEL
- ARG
-
Added your SSH key to your GitHub account
-
Setup your local git with your preferred and email to identify commits
-
Create a private repository in the GitHub organization with your preferred name
-
Do some research on:
-
git reset (soft, hash, and mixed),
- git revert
- git cherry-pick
- git rebase
- git stash
- git tag
- git restore
- pull request
- pull request template
- merge conflict
- code review
- change request
- branch protection
- code freeze
- hotfix
-
Do some research on:
- Continuous integration
- Continuous delivery
- Continuous deployment
- Continuous monitoring
-
Do some research on the below environment:
- dev
- QA
- stg or pre-prod
- prod
-
Do some research about the below branch:
- develop or development branch
- release branch
- feature branch
- stg branch
- prod branch
- qa branch
- declarative pipeline Vs scripted pipeline
- all jenkins environment variables
- node pipeline example
- Fonctions, move all stages and replace with functions
- credentials
- when condition
- if, elif and else
- and and or
- labels
- Conditions
- approval before deployment